חיפוש בתיעוד...

התחילו להקליד כדי לחפש בתיעוד

librechat
LibreChat

מדריך אינטגרציה של LibreChat

חברו את UnoRouter אל LibreChat דרך נקודת קצה מותאמת תואמת OpenAI.

סקירה כללית

LibreChat חושף כל מארח תואם OpenAI דרך endpoints.custom. הוסיפו בלוק UnoRouter, הגדירו את משתנה הסביבה, ובורר המודלים מתמלא אוטומטית מהקטלוג.

הגדרה מהירה

הזינו ערכים אלה בלקוח. המפתח שלכם מתמלא אוטומטית כשאתם מחוברים.

text
כתובת URL בסיסית: https://api.unorouter.ai/v1
מפתח API: YOUR_API_KEY

התחברו למילוי אוטומטי של מפתח ה-API שלכם

תאימות

Chat Completionsהזרמהקריאת כלים

הגדרה שלב אחר שלב

  1. 1
    ערכו את librechat.yaml

    בהתקנת LibreChat שלכם, הוסיפו בלוק נקודת קצה מותאמת תחת endpoints.custom.

    yaml
    endpoints:
      custom:
        - name: 'UnoRouter'
          apiKey: '${UNOROUTER_API_KEY}'
          baseURL: 'https://api.unorouter.ai/v1'
          models:
            fetch: true
          titleConvo: true
          modelDisplayLabel: 'UnoRouter'

    התחברו למילוי אוטומטי של מפתח ה-API שלכם

  2. 2
    הוסיפו את משתנה הסביבה

    הגדירו את מפתח ה API של UnoRouter בקובץ ה env. של LibreChat.

  3. 3
    הפעילו מחדש את LibreChat

    הפעילו מחדש את הקונטיינר או התהליך. נקודת הקצה של UnoRouter מופיעה בתפריט הצאט.

מודלים מומלצים

מודלים חינמיים שעובדים טוב כאן. הדביקו כל מזהה מודל בלקוח.

openai-fastmistral-vibe-cli-latestmistral-code-fim-latestmistral-small-latestmistral-code-agent-latest

נקודות לתשומת לב

  • השתמשו בתחביר סוגר בודד עבור ערכי משתני סביבה, לא בתחביר הסודות של חלק מהתצורות האחרות.
  • אם מודל דוחה פרמטרים נוספים של OpenAI, הוסיפו אותם ל dropParams (למשל frequency_penalty ו presence_penalty).
  • fetch: true ממלא אוטומטית מהקטלוג של UnoRouter. שלבו עם default כדי להציג קודם את המודלים המועדפים.
ייצור מפתח APIמודלים